WebOften a practice known as curbstoning (salesperson or dealer selling cars on the side). May involve sketchy cars they wouldn't or couldn't sell as a dealer. They do it in some cases to avoid certain dealer specific taxes, and it makes it harder for the buyer to track them down when there are problems with the car or title.

WebCurbstoning is when a dealer poses as a private seller to sell a car. By curbstoning, an unethical dealer can avoid having to comply with the regulations that apply to dealers. To a buyer, this could mean buying a car that has a salvaged title (a car that’s been declared a total loss by an insurance company). WebCurbstoning is the repeated, unlicensed commercial sale of used cars for profit. It is not an ordinary citizen selling one or two vehicles.
